What are email notifications?

We use email and push notifications to alert and remind users about important things. For example, you can set up reminders for visits or upcoming events, or notify you about changes to your care network, or let you know when there's a new note posted to your notebook. By allowing email or push notifications, this mean Five Good Friends can alert and direct you to important information without you having to login to your account and check for yourself.

How to turn on email notifications

  1. Login to your account via the web here, or open the Five Good Friends app on your smartphone.

  2. Select "Notifications" in the top menu bar if on web, or in the bottom tab bar if using the app.

  3. In notifications, you'll see a button labelled. "Settings" - select that.

  4. In the notifications settings, you can now choose which notifications you'd like to receive via email by turning those switches on.

I'm receiving an alert saying "Push notifications are switched off"

  • If you're interested in using push notifications as well, then please select the button labeled 'Switch on in settings' and allow push notifications for the 5GF app.

  • Otherwise, if you only want to receive email notifications select 'Not right now'

  • You can now see a list of notification types and turn the switch on (blue) or off (grey) for the notifications you want to receive via email.
